Building Collective Impact for Aging
By 2015, the 65+ population will make up 14 percent of Michigan’s population. By 2030, the population will be 20 percent, while other groups of prime working age will decline. What support systems do we have in place to support … Continue reading

The Perpetuity Question: To Continue to Be or Not to Be?
While existing in perpetuity continues to be the norm for the majority of family foundations, the limited life options – also known as spending out or sunsetting – is attracting more attention. Learn about the motivations, strategies and experiences associated … Continue reading

Brave New World: The Power (and Challenges) of Coordinated Funding
As in most communities, funders of human service programs in Washtenaw County traditionally engaged in parallel, uncoordinated grantmaking.
